Explore Jakarta: A 2-Day Itinerary for Culture and Cuisine

Day 1: Culture & History
Jakarta, Indonesia
8:00AM
Breakfast at Warung Rindu
Start your day with a traditional Indonesian breakfast at Warung Rindu, trying their delicious Gado-Gado and kopi tubruk for an authentic local experience.
Located in Central Jakarta, easily reachable by taxi.
IDR 50,000, 1 hour
9:30AM
Visit the National Museum
Explore Indonesia's rich heritage at the National Museum, where you'll discover artifacts, historical exhibits, and archaeological treasures.
A short 10-minute taxi ride from the restaurant.
IDR 10,000, 2 hours
12:00PM
Lunch at Cafe Batavia
Enjoy lunch at the charming Cafe Batavia in the Old Town, known for its classic dishes and beautiful colonial architecture.
A 20-minute drive from the museum to Kota Tua.
IDR 150,000, 1.5 hours
1:30PM
Explore Kota Tua (Old Town)
Stroll through Jakarta's historical district, visiting attractions like Fatahillah Square and the Jakarta History Museum.
Walking distance from Cafe Batavia.
Free, 2 hours
3:30PM
Visit the Istiqlal Mosque
Experience the grandeur of the Istiqlal Mosque, the largest mosque in Southeast Asia, and reflect on its stunning architecture.
A 15-minute taxi ride from Kota Tua.
Free, 1 hour
5:00PM
Dinner at Sate Shinta
Indulge in authentic Indonesian Sate at Sate Shinta, where you can savor a variety of skewered meat dishes grilled to perfection.
A 10-minute ride from the mosque.
IDR 100,000, 1.5 hours
7:00PM
Relax at Ancol Dreamland
Wind down your day with a visit to Ancol Dreamland, where you can enjoy the beach, amusement parks, and live entertainment.
A 20-minute taxi ride from the restaurant.
IDR 25,000, Evening

Day 2: Modern Vibes & Shopping
Jakarta, Indonesia
8:00AM
Breakfast at The Harvest
Begin your day with a scrumptious breakfast at The Harvest, famous for its pastries and coffee.
A 20-minute drive from your accommodation.
IDR 70,000, 1 hour
9:30AM
Visit to the National Gallery of Indonesia
Admire contemporary and traditional art at the National Gallery, showcasing local and international masterpieces.
A quick 10-minute drive from the cafe.
Free, 1.5 hours
11:00AM
Explore the Plaza Senayan
Head to Plaza Senayan for some upscale shopping and luxury brands, perfect for those looking to indulge or enjoy window shopping.
A 15-minute taxi ride.
Free to browse, 2 hours
1:00PM
Lunch at Din Tai Fung
Savor the world-renowned Xiao Long Bao (soup dumplings) and other Taiwanese favorites for lunch at Din Tai Fung, located in the Plaza.
Located within Plaza Senayan.
IDR 150,000, 1.5 hours
2:30PM
Visit Taman Mini Indonesia Indah
Explore Taman Mini, a cultural park that showcases the diverse cultures and traditions across Indonesia through pavilions and performances.
A 30-minute taxi ride from the plaza.
IDR 20,000, 2 hours
4:30PM
Coffee Break at Tanamera Coffee
Refuel with a coffee break at Tanamera Coffee, where you can enjoy some of the best Indonesian brews.
A 15-minute drive from Taman Mini.
IDR 50,000, 1 hour
6:00PM
Dinner at The Duck King
End your Jakarta trip with a delicious dinner at The Duck King, known for their Peking Duck and beautiful Asian-inspired decor.
A 20-minute taxi ride from Tanamera Coffee.
IDR 200,000, 1.5 hours
